--- Begin Message --- Subject: 25.1; hl-line-mode makes text disappear Date: Sun, 18 Sep 2016 19:50:22 +0000
From emacs -Q:
M-x global-hl-line-mode
then open a file and move around with C-n

Text at the current line disappears seemingly at random. It comes back eventually and/or if I do C-l.

It does this regardless of major mode and I experienced the behavior in 24.5 and 25.1

--- Begin Message --- Subject: Re: bug#24463: 25.1; hl-line-mode makes text disappear Date: Tue, 20 Sep 2016 05:26:19 +0300
> From: Alex Branham <address@hidden>
> Date: Mon, 19 Sep 2016 20:14:44 +0000
> Cc: address@hidden
> 
> Since the Arch Wiki (https://wiki.archlinux.org/index.php/intel_graphics) 
> suggests that the kernel modesetting
> may be better than the intel graphics package, I uninstalled that package 
> just to see if that would fix the issue.
> After uninstalling and rebooting the computer, I have not experienced this 
> weird disappearing/duplicating text
> issue. 
> 
> I don't know enough about this to tell whether this is a bug in that intel 
> graphics package or emacs. 

I'm quite sure it's not an Emacs problem.

Thanks, I'm closing the bug report.
